Key Responsibilities

  • Development and execution of an individual business plan to achieve new client acquisition, business line referrals and product/business line penetration inside portfolios; achievement of retention objectives; and consistent portfolio growth.
  • Responsible for significant growth in assets under management and revenue growth resulting in a profitable book of business.
  • Proactively review current book to ensure proper client segmentation and transition to appropriate resources.
  • Deliver a distinctive client experience that leverages our unique value proposition through the referral of wealth, mortgage, insurance, private banking and commercial banking.
  • Ability to articulate and conversant in all aspects of our business offerings as well as financial industry topics/trends and financial planning topics.
  • Understand client's financial objectives through consistent purposeful discovery process by integrating financial planning concepts and process.
  • Match prospect needs with JFG Business Partners to provide solutions resulting in closed new business and expanding depth of relationship.
  • May manage FA Sales Assistant, Registered Assistant and/or Administrative Assistant.
  • Execution of our comprehensive sales process which includes successful prospecting, planning and gaining new business.
  • Knowledge of full portfolio of JFG products and services; actively cross-sells full breadth and depth of products. Responsible for meeting or exceeding sales, cross-sales and referral goals.
  • Manage a team of associates to meet and exceed performance expectations; monitor and hold staff accountable for their performance and their actions.
  • Create and sustain an environment which supports teamwork and mutual respect.

Required Experience

  • Bachelors or advanced degree in finance, accounting, economics, business management or relevant area of study preferred, work experience may be considered in lieu of education.
  • Minimum of 2 years experience in the financial industry in a client facing business development role.
  • Financial experience must include demonstrated analytical, problem solving, strategic and tactical thinking/implementation skills
  • Developed networking skills, comprehensive understanding of group dynamics and working with Centers of Influence.
  • Solid understanding of finance and economic principles.
  • Must be focused on industry and competitive trends and exhibit a proactive approach to product and technology needs to remain relevant to our clients.
  • Series 7, 63 or 66 required or must be obtained within 6 months
  • All state required Insurance licenses.
